What can I see and do near Kozukappara Execution Grounds?
Tokyo National Museum, Tokyo National Science Museum and Tokyo Metropolitan Art Museum feature captivating exhibits. Sensoji Temple, Tokyo Imperial Palace and Asakusa Shrine are landmarks that you won't want to miss. You can watch performances at Asakusa Public Hall, Tokyo Bunka Kaikan and Sumida Triphony Hall if you're interested in local theatre.
How can I get to Kozukappara Execution Grounds?
With so many choices for transport, seeing the area around Kozukappara Execution Grounds is a breeze.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Arakawa-nichome Station, Arakawa-kuyakushomae Station and Arakawa-nanachome Station. If you're taking a train into town, Machiya Station, Mikawashima Station and Shin-Mikawashima Station are the closest train stations to Arakawa.
